    Stockton

    The urban residential neighborhood of Stockton sits on the edge of Camden City, bordering Pennsauken Township and sharing amenities like grocery stores and popular restaurants.     Cramer Hill

    One of East Camden’s most historic neighborhoods, Cramer Hill sits along the Delaware River, a skip from downtown Camden and a hop over from Philadelphia.     Dudley

    Located just minutes from Downtown Camden and 5 miles from Philadelphia’s Center City, Dudley is home to a range of eateries serving cuisine from around the globe and local businesses like barbershops and mini-marts.
